In the precharge phase, the battery is charged with the precharge current (IPRECHG). Once the battery voltage
crosses the VLOWV threshold, the battery is charged with the fast-charge current (ICHG). As the battery voltage
reaches VBAT(REG), the battery is held at a constant voltage of VBAT(REG) and the charge current tapers off as the
battery approaches full charge. When the battery current reaches ITERM, the CHG pin indicates charging done by
going high impedance.
IPRECHG = KPRECHG/RISET
(1)
Termination detection is disabled whenever the charge rate is reduced because of the actions of the thermal
loop, the DPPM loop, or the VIN(LOW) loop.
The value of the fast-charge current is set by the resistor connected from the ISET pin to VSS, and is given by
Equation 2:
ICHG = KISET/RISET
(2)
The charge current limit is adjustable from 25 mA to 500 mA. The valid resistor range is 1.74 kΩ to 34.8 kΩ.
Note that if ICHG is programmed as greater than the input current limit, the battery does not charge at the rate of
ICHG, but at the slower rate of IIN(MAX) (minus the load current on the OUT pin, if any). In this case, the charger
timers are proportionately slowed down.
